I don't think the later cars are wired for 2 signals on the tach. How are you going to make that work?
The turn signal indicator light and parking brake indicator are on the same relay. I'll just disconnect the turn signal indicator light.
Since the front and rear turn signal lamps are connected in parallel, I'll just connect the new R & L turn signal dash lamps in parallel with them. This way when a turn signal is on, the proper indicator lamp will flash.
The early cars had some strange arrangement with the L & R indicator lamps such that each lamp has one connection to the front and rear turn signal lamps, and the other side of the lamps were connected together and connected to the flash unit. The flash unit was supposed to pull the common connection of the indicators to ground when the turn signal was on.
On my 71, this common connection in the flasher was not working when I purchased it and both lamps would flash at 1/2 brightness when either turn signal was on. After coming to the conclusion that the flash unit was faulty, I simply disconnected the common connection from the flash unit and attached it to ground.
I'm not sure what function I disabled with the move of the common connection but things seem to work ok and nothing fried.
